Lululemon promotes Burgoyne to lead retail operations in Americas

Published
Dec 12, 2016

Lululemon announced on Monday the promotion of Celeste Burgoyne to executive vice-president of retail, Americas, effective immediately.

Burgoyne, who has been with Lululemon since 2006 and was most recently senior VP of retail in North America, will be responsible for leading the wider Americas retail organisation the region.  

The yoga-inspired athletic apparel company said Burgoyne has a deep understanding of the brand’s operations across the geography.

“The Americas is our largest operation and remains a critical part of our future. I know Celeste’s leadership will ensure a laser focus on expanding our footprint, exploring new formats and creating new and engaging ways to connect with our guests,” said company CEO Laurent Potdevin.

Burgoyne has been responsible for overseeing the company’s Canadian and US retail divisions snd previously spent 10 years at Abercrombie & Fitch, where she held a variety of roles including senior director of stores.

Burgoyne will continue to report to Potdevin.
